Dec 28, 2018 at 14:08 | comment | added | moonboots | I've tested and it works, so you must have skipped a step, I've edited my answer, you need to remove from any group: in Edit mode select your belt and in the Properties panel > Data > Vertex Groups and Remove From All Groups function, then in Weight Paint you assign it to the bones that you want with the Limit Selection to Visible option disabled (on the horizontal menu bar) | |
